The Real Reasons for Hybrid Workers to Come to the Office

Allwork

The hybrid workforce doesn’t despise the office; rather, the commute is the villain of the story, as surveys highlight. Peer-reviewed research paints an even more sinister picture, with commuting times linked to diminished job satisfaction, escalating stress, and declining mental health.
